What is RTP and Why It Matters
RTP refers to the percentage of all wagered money that an online slot returns to players over time. For example, if a slot has a 96% RTP, it means that theoretically, for every $100 wagered, players receive $96 back as winnings. The remaining 4% represents the house edge.
Understanding this concept helps you make informed decisions about which games offer better value. Reputable online casinos display RTP information clearly, and responsible players always check these figures before spinning the reels.
High RTP vs Low RTP Slots
Slots with 95% or higher RTP are generally considered player-friendly. Games with RTPs below 90% tend to favor the casino more heavily. However, remember that RTP is calculated over thousands of spins, so individual sessions can vary dramatically.
